Financial Analysts focus on evaluating financial records and reports to ensure accuracy and compliance. They help organizations make informed financial decisions and provide guidance on economic trends. Forensic Accountants, on the other hand, delve deeper into financial records and statements with the objective of detecting fraudulent activities, irregularities, and other misconduct. They are trained to present their findings in a manner that is suitable for court proceedings. Auditors and Compliance Officers are also important roles in the sector. Auditors ensure that an organization's financial statements and records are accurate, while Compliance Officers monitor and ensure adherence to laws, regulations, and standards. In terms of salary packages, Financial Analysts typically earn between £30,000 and £50,000 annually, with senior roles offering six-figure salaries. Forensic Accountants' salaries range between £40,000 and £70,000, with top earners receiving up to £90,000. Auditors' salaries range between £25,000 and £55,000, and Compliance Officers' salaries range between £30,000 and £60,000.
